Apple Dump Cake
Apple Dump Cake is an easy and irresistible Fall dessert that's made with just 4 ingredients: apple pie filling, cake mix, pecans, and butter!

Ingredients
2
21 ounce cans apple pie filling
1
16.25 ounce box white cake mix
12
Tablespoons
salted butter,
cut into 12 pieces
¼
cup
chopped pecans
FOR SERVING:
vanilla ice cream

Instructions
Move oven rack to middle position and preheat oven to 350 degrees F.
Pour the pie filling into a 9 x 13-inch pyrex pan and smooth into an even layer.
Sprinkle the cake mix evenly over the pie filling.
Space out the butter pieces evenly over the cake mix.
Sprinkle the chopped pecans over the top. Bake until golden brown and the sides are bubbling, about 35-40 minutes.
Let the cake cool for 10 minutes, and then serve with vanilla ice cream (optional).
